Software Development Co-op Opportunity

2 days ago


Toronto, Ontario, Canada Lumerate Full time $24 - $29
Software Development Co-op Opportunity

Lumerate, a Toronto-based SaaS company, is seeking a talented software development co-op student to join our team. As a co-op student, you will have the opportunity to gain hands-on experience in software development, working on real-world projects and collaborating with our experienced team.

About the Role

We are looking for a motivated and detail-oriented co-op student to join our software development team. As a co-op student, you will be responsible for:

  • Writing production code and contributing to the development of our customer-facing Rails application
  • Mentorship from our engineering team to create innovative solutions to challenging problems
  • Maintaining the data infrastructure used by Lumerate's products
  • Ensuring the appropriate degree of rigor in testing is maintained
  • Investigating new technological approaches and proposing pragmatic solutions that will scale to the requirements of the business

Our Tech Stack

We use a variety of technologies, including Ruby on Rails, Javascript, ReactJS, Linux, ElasticSearch, Docker, NoSQL, and PostgreSQL. As a co-op student, you will have the opportunity to work with these technologies and gain hands-on experience.

About You

We are looking for a co-op student who is:

  • Enrolled in their 3rd or 4th year of a Software Engineering or Computer Science program
  • A Canadian citizen, permanent resident, or have otherwise obtained the appropriate visa/permissions to work as a co-op student in Canada
  • Detail-oriented and enjoys puzzles
  • Experienced with Ruby on Rails or other MVC frameworks (a bonus)
  • Willing to make a minimum 8-month commitment to us
  • Thrives as part of a team, but is also comfortable with self-directed learning

Perks

We offer a competitive hourly rate, opportunities for professional growth and development, and a dynamic and supportive work environment. As a co-op student, you will also have the opportunity to work remotely or hybrid from our office in Toronto's Junction Triangle.

How to Apply

Please submit your resume and a cover letter explaining why you are a strong fit for this co-op opportunity. We look forward to hearing from you



  • Toronto, Ontario, Canada Lumerate Full time

    Software Development Co-op Opportunity at LumerateLumerate, a leading provider of software solutions for the life sciences industry, is seeking a highly motivated and detail-oriented co-op student to join our team as a Software Development Co-op. As a co-op student, you will have the opportunity to work on real-world projects, gain hands-on experience with...


  • Toronto, Ontario, Canada Lumerate Full time

    Software Development Co-op Opportunity at LumerateLumerate, a leading provider of software solutions for the life sciences industry, is seeking a highly motivated and detail-oriented co-op student to join our team as a Software Development Co-op. As a co-op student, you will have the opportunity to work on real-world projects, gain hands-on experience with...


  • Old Toronto, Ontario, Canada Intuit Inc. Full time

    About the RoleWe are seeking a highly motivated and skilled Co-op Software Developer to join our team at Intuit Inc. As a Co-op Software Developer, you will be responsible for driving innovation and delivering high-quality mobile applications that meet the needs of our customers.Key ResponsibilitiesArchitecting and Developing Mobile Features: Design,...


  • Old Toronto, Ontario, Canada Intuit Inc. Full time

    About the RoleWe are seeking a highly motivated and skilled Co-op Software Developer to join our team at Intuit Inc. As a Co-op Software Developer, you will be responsible for driving innovation and delivering high-quality mobile applications that meet the needs of our customers.Key ResponsibilitiesArchitecting and Developing Mobile Features: Design,...


  • Toronto, Ontario, Canada Fidelity Canada Full time

    About Fidelity CanadaFidelity Canada is a leading provider of investment solutions, helping individuals and institutions build better financial futures. With a rich history of innovation, we're constantly seeking talented individuals to join our team.Job DescriptionWe're seeking a highly motivated Co-op Student to join our Software Development team. As a...


  • Toronto, Ontario, Canada Fidelity Canada Full time

    About Fidelity CanadaFidelity Canada is a leading provider of investment solutions, helping individuals and institutions build better financial futures. With a rich history of innovation, we're constantly seeking talented individuals to join our team.Job DescriptionWe're seeking a highly motivated Co-op Student to join our Software Development team. As a...


  • Toronto, Ontario, Canada Fidelity Canada Full time

    About Fidelity CanadaFidelity Canada is a leading provider of investment solutions, helping Canadian investors build better financial futures for over 35 years. Our company is committed to innovation, diversity, and inclusion, making us an ideal place for students to grow and develop their careers.Job DescriptionWe are seeking a highly motivated and...


  • Toronto, Ontario, Canada Fidelity Canada Full time

    About Fidelity CanadaFidelity Canada is a leading provider of investment solutions, helping Canadian investors build better financial futures for over 35 years. Our company is committed to innovation, diversity, and inclusion, making us an ideal place for students to grow and develop their careers.Job DescriptionWe are seeking a highly motivated and...


  • Old Toronto, Ontario, Canada Intuit Inc. Full time

    We are seeking a talented software engineering co-op to join our developer success and knowledge management team at Intuit Inc. As a co-op, you will be working closely with our team to create innovative tools that facilitate knowledge management and discovery, enabling our engineers to quickly find the information they need to excel in their roles and share...


  • Old Toronto, Ontario, Canada Intuit Inc. Full time

    We are seeking a talented software engineering co-op to join our developer success and knowledge management team at Intuit Inc. As a co-op, you will be working closely with our team to create innovative tools that facilitate knowledge management and discovery, enabling our engineers to quickly find the information they need to excel in their roles and share...


  • Toronto, Ontario, Canada Intuit Full time

    About the RoleWe are seeking a highly motivated and skilled Software Development Co-op to join our team at Intuit. As a key member of our team, you will be responsible for driving innovation and delivering delightful user experiences for TurboTax Canada.Key ResponsibilitiesArchitect, design, and develop mobile features, prototypes, or proof-of-conceptsGather...


  • Toronto, Ontario, Canada Intuit Full time

    About the RoleWe are seeking a highly motivated and skilled Software Development Co-op to join our team at Intuit. As a key member of our team, you will be responsible for driving innovation and delivering delightful user experiences for TurboTax Canada.Key ResponsibilitiesArchitect, design, and develop mobile features, prototypes, or proof-of-conceptsGather...


  • Toronto, Ontario, Canada Intuit Full time

    About the RoleWe are seeking a highly motivated and skilled Software Development Co-op to join our team at Intuit. As a key member of our team, you will be responsible for driving innovation and delivering delightful user experiences for TurboTax Canada.Key ResponsibilitiesArchitect, design, and develop mobile features, prototypes, or proof-of-conceptsGather...


  • Toronto, Ontario, Canada Loblaw Companies Limited Full time

    Software Development Co-Op Job DescriptionLoblaw Digital is seeking a talented Software Development Co-Op to join our team. As a Co-Op, you will play a vital role in our AI-driven initiatives, working alongside our skilled machine learning, data science, and engineering teams.Key Responsibilities:Collaborate with cross-functional teams to deliver innovative...


  • Toronto, Ontario, Canada Intuit Full time

    About IntuitIntuit is a global financial technology company that powers prosperity for the people and communities we serve. With approximately 100 million customers worldwide using products such as TurboTax, Credit Karma, QuickBooks, and Mailchimp, we believe that everyone should have the opportunity to prosper.Our MissionWe never stop working to find new,...


  • Toronto, Ontario, Canada Intuit Full time

    About IntuitIntuit is a global financial technology company that powers prosperity for the people and communities we serve. With approximately 100 million customers worldwide using products such as TurboTax, Credit Karma, QuickBooks, and Mailchimp, we believe that everyone should have the opportunity to prosper.Our MissionWe never stop working to find new,...


  • Toronto, Ontario, Canada Loblaw Companies Limited Full time

    Software Development Co-op OpportunityLoblaw Digital is seeking a talented and motivated Software Development Co-op to join our team. As a key member of our AI-driven initiatives, you will work alongside our skilled machine learning, data science, and engineering teams to deliver innovative solutions that enhance customer experiences and optimize internal...


  • Toronto, Ontario, Canada Loblaw Companies Limited Full time

    Software Development Co-op OpportunityLoblaw Digital is seeking a talented and motivated Software Development Co-op to join our team. As a key member of our AI-driven initiatives, you will work alongside our skilled machine learning, data science, and engineering teams to deliver innovative solutions that enhance customer experiences and optimize internal...


  • Toronto, Ontario, Canada MV Engineering Full time

    Software Engineering Intern/Co-Op OpportunityWe are seeking a highly motivated and detail-oriented Software Engineering intern/co-op to join our team at MV Engineering. As a software engineering intern/co-op, you will have the opportunity to work closely with our software engineers to build and maintain our software applications.ResponsibilitiesCollaborate...


  • Toronto, Ontario, Canada MV Engineering Full time

    Software Engineering Intern/Co-Op OpportunityWe are seeking a highly motivated and detail-oriented Software Engineering intern/co-op to join our team at MV Engineering. As a software engineering intern/co-op, you will have the opportunity to work closely with our software engineers to build and maintain our software applications.ResponsibilitiesCollaborate...